Who in their crazy mind thought Allen bolts were cool for camshafts? F u Volvo! by funnyempathy21 in Justrolledintotheshop

[–]bcuzitsnotanelephant 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Tap those bolts on the head with your ball peen to shock them loose, and use a good quality t30 to crack them. Those things can be a real bigger sometimes, I deal with those on a weekly basis as a Volvo tech

What's the nub for on the bottom of Allen keys? by Lingoman5 in Tools

[–]bcuzitsnotanelephant 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Ball ends, great for when a straight Allen does not fit due to space constraints / obstructions. I love my snap on set

I replaced my Key fob battery for the first time today but I am still getting the same error any clues to solve it ? by victorshab in Volvo

[–]bcuzitsnotanelephant 5 points6 points  (0 children)

Verify voltage of both batteries are above 3v with a multimeter, if not, replace with good quality CR2430

I'm about to go see a S80 T6 2009 soon this week by Zuuuuppp in VolvoRWD

[–]bcuzitsnotanelephant 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I wouldn’t go as far to say the 5 is way less complicated than a 6. Personally I see about the same amount of issues with the RNC 5 cylinders than the 6’s working on them everyday. The t5 and t6 are not even comparable in terms of driveablity though. The 6 makes much more torque and feels way better moving the p3 chassis around
